What is 14762.mfc140d.dll?

A DLL (Dynamic Link Library) file, like 14762.mfc140d.dll, is a crucial part of a computer's software system. It contains code and data that multiple programs can use simultaneously, which helps save memory and simplify software updates. In the case of 14762.mfc140d.dll, it is related to the software Microsoft Visual Studio Enterprise 2015, providing important functions and resources for this specific program to work properly.

DLL files, despite their significant role in system functionality, can sometimes trigger system error messages. The subsequent list features some the most common DLL error messages that users may encounter.

  • 14762.mfc140d.dll not found: This indicates that the application you're trying to run is looking for a specific DLL file that it can't locate. This could be due to the DLL file being missing, corrupted, or incorrectly installed.
  • 14762.mfc140d.dll Access Violation: This indicates a process tried to access or modify a memory location related to 14762.mfc140d.dll that it isn't allowed to. This is often a sign of problems with the software using the DLL, such as bugs or corruption.
  • 14762.mfc140d.dll could not be loaded: This error suggests that the system was unable to load the DLL file into memory. This could happen due to file corruption, incompatibility, or because the file is missing or incorrectly installed.
  • The file 14762.mfc140d.dll is missing: This message means that the system was unable to locate the DLL file needed for a particular operation or software. The absence of this file could be due to a flawed installation process or an aggressive antivirus action.
  • Cannot register 14762.mfc140d.dll: This suggests that the DLL file could not be registered by the system, possibly due to inconsistencies or errors in the Windows Registry. Another reason might be that the DLL file is not in the correct directory or is missing.
